How does the Supreme Court usually rule in cases that involve overcrowding in prisons?

Answer:

It upholds the 8th Amendment.

Explanation:

The Supreme Court usually confirms the eight amendment which states that punishments must be fair, cannot be cruel, and that fines that are extraordinarily large cannot be set. This is supported stating that although they are prisoners, overcrowding in penitentiaries is cruel and unusual as this conditions are not suitable for decent living standards.
